
Goods vehicle drivers and dispatchers need information on fuel stations and rest areas on their route both before and during their trip. This basic freight traffic need can be covered by Intelligent Truck Parking (ITP) Services, which produce and distribute static and dynamic information on the truck parking situation on the motorway networks and access roads. Thus the management of parking spaces and the observation of rest and driving periods for drivers are supported resulting in the reduction of dangerous parking and in the improvement of drivers, load and goods vehicle safety and security. The information could be provided on-trip and pre-trip using different channels of information and different end-user devices.
Continuing the initiative and the target taken on this matter during the Actions URSA MAJOR and URSA MAJOR 2, URSA MAJOR neo aims at implementing the Intelligent Truck Parking (ITP) core services for safe and secure parking places according to:
- the priority area of the EU-ITS action plan No. 3: Road Safety and Security Action 3.5: Services for safe and secure truck parking places
- the European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) No 885/2013 (regarding the provision of information services for safe and secure parking places for trucks and commercial vehicles)
- the ITS Deployment Guideline for Freight & Logistic Services: FLS-DG01 Intelligent and Secure Truck Parking
The scope of the activity directly addresses Article 5 of Regulation (EU) No 1315/2013: Union guidelines for development of trans-European transport network, in particular b) c) d) e) and f).
The UMneo project addresses then the European dimension for the area of the URSA MAJOR network. Beyond the mere collection and publication of information on existing truck parking areas (static information), it addresses the capacity enhancement of truck parking areas by using ITS technology as well as the provision of real-time information on availability of truck parking (dynamic information), making this data available for service providers. This will speed up the implementation of the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) No 885/2013 on Information Services for Secure Parking in the entire area of the UMneo network.
Beyond extending and accelerating the deployment of ITP on the TEN-T core road network in Germany and ltaly, UMneo opens up a new dimension in addressing the urban/inter-urban interface to major intermodal freight hubs (ports). lt is a major need to improve the cooperation of the management of intermodal freight hubs and the surrounding road networks in order to keep traffic out of the hub area in overload situations. lnforming incoming traffic about the delays to be expected and at the same time about parking opportunities on the motorway already before entering the hub area (e.g. the port) is an important means of traffic management that requires active cooperation between road operator and hub/port operator.
For this Activity there are 5 different implementations ongoing in Germany and Italy, expected to be completed by the end of 2020.
